Weekday Easy "Under 30 Minutes" Pork Tenderloin Alfredo
Ingredients
- Fusilli cut pasta of your choice, about 12 ounces , cooked and drained
- 2 T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- 1 lb pork tenderloin, cut into bite-size pieces
- 1 medium red pepper, cut in thin strips
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 Tbsp cornstarch
- 3 cups 2% milk
- 3/4 cup freshly grated Romano cheese
Directions
|
- Saute pork in 1 tablespoon oil in a large skillet over Medium-High heat, about 3 minutes. Remove from pan.
- Sauté red pepper in 1 tablespoon oil until tender, about 3 minutes. Add garlic and saute 1 minute longer. Return pork to pan.
- Mix cornstarch with milk and add to the skillet; bring to a boil, stirring until thickened, about 4 minutes. Reduce heat to Low, add cheese, season with salt and pepper and simmer 2 minutes longer.
- Toss with cooked pasta.
